Fractional Distillation Plant

Fractional Distillation at Muez-Hest facilitates the precise separation of fatty acid mixtures into composite cuts or individual components. Our process employs vacuum columns equipped with structured packing to ensure high separation efficiency and minimal pressure drop. A falling film method gently evaporates the liquid phase, with vapors condensed in a surface condenser tailored for optimal heat recovery.

 

Fractional distillation of fatty acids is critical in industries requiring high purity and precise separation, such as the pharmaceutical industry, where it supports the production of active pharmaceutical ingredients (APIs) and excipients with specific chain lengths. In the chemical industry, this process is vital for maintaining the purity and composition of fatty acids in various compounds. The Fatty Acid Distillation Process

  • Step 1

    Preparation

    Crude fatty acids are first subjected to drying and degassing to remove moisture and gases. They are then introduced into the first fractionation column under residual vacuum conditions.

  • Step 2

    Fractionation

    First Column: The initial fractionation occurs in Column 1, where the fatty acid chains C8-C12 are separated and extracted from the column's top. The remaining heavier fractions are collected at the bottom.
    Second Column: The bottom product from Column 1 is transferred to Column 2, where further separation occurs under vacuum. This column can be tailored to separate either C14-C12 or a broader range such as C12-C14-C16 fatty acid chains.
    Third Column: Finally, the remaining bottom product is fed into Column 3, where the C16-C18 fatty acid chains are isolated.

  • Step 3

    Heat Recovery

    The process incorporates a surface condenser in Column 2 that facilitates heat recovery through steam generation, followed by a final condenser to optimize energy efficiency.

  • Step 4

    Separation Efficiency

    The use of vacuum columns with structured packing allows for high separation efficiency and minimal pressure drop. Additionally, the falling film method ensures gentle evaporation of the liquid phase, preserving the integrity of the fatty acids.
